Coast Guard medevacs man from cruise ship Carnival Paradise near Tampa
ST. PETERSBURG Fla. — A 63-year-old man was medevaced by the Coast Guard 12 miles west of Tampa, Saturday.
The captain of the cruise ship Carnival Paradise contacted Coast Guard Sector St. Petersburg watchstanders at 8:04 p.m., reporting the man was experiencing heart attack symptoms and required medical assistance.

50-year-old man medically evacuated from cruise ship Carnival Paradise near Venice, Fla.

VENICE, Fla. — A 50-year-old man was medically evacuated from the cruise ship Carnival Paradise approximately 30-miles west of Venice, Saturday.
Watchstanders at Coast Guard Sector St. Petersburg received a request at 10:30 p.m., from crewmembers of the Carnival Paradise for a medical evacuation of a 50-year-old man who was suffering from a suspected cardiac attack.

Coast Guard medevacs cruise ship passenger
SAN DIEGO – A boat crew from Coast Guard Station San Diego medically evacuated a cruise ship passenger who experienced a possible stroke off the coast of San Diego early Sunday morning.

Coast Guard Medevacs Woman from Cruise Ship
SAN DIEGO – The Coast Guard medically evacuated a woman from a cruise ship about 12 miles east of San Clemente Island, Calif., in the early morning hours Tuesday.
Coast Guard medevacs cruise ship passenger
SAN DIEGO — A MH-60 Jayhawk helicopter crew from Coast Guard Sector San Diego medically evacuated a cruise ship passenger 40 miles west of San Diego late Friday night.
